Chilly Reception
~
Outside the curtains was cold. Severus was chilled to the bone after getting out of bed. But he quickly warmed under Remus’ heated look. Regulus pointedly turned away.
“Right,” said Remus once they’d dressed. “Here’s what we do. Regulus, you’re small, you can join us under the Cloak. Then, we’ll sneak past him.”
“Who’s going to open the door?” asked Regulus.
“We’ll open it while still hidden under the Cloak. I dunno about Slytherin, but there’s always a draft in Gryffindor. Doors are constantly opening spontaneously.”
Regulus looked at Severus. “Your boyfriend’s clever.”
Severus blushed, finding it hard to disagree.
~
When the door opened it revealed Avery leaning up against the wall, wand in hand. He looked like he meant business, the expression in his eyes chilling Severus to the bone.
He tensed when the door opened, relaxing when he didn’t see anyone.
Holding their breath, they remained crouched under the Cloak as they shuffled past, and it wasn’t until they got to the empty common room that Severus could breathe again.
Once outside and away from Slytherin, Remus finally pulled off the Cloak. “God,” he gasped. “That was scary.”
Severus smiled. It had been, but he’d felt oddly safe.
